Hoosiers Make History: A Perfect Season and Their First National Title

Victory at Last: Indiana's Historic Triumph

MIAMI GARDENS, Fla. — On a night that will forever be etched in college football lore, the Indiana Hoosiers not only capped off an undefeated 16-0 season but also claimed their first national championship by outlasting the Miami Hurricanes 27-21 at Hard Rock Stadium. Coach Curt Cignetti's squad entered the arena with a palpable sense of confidence, intent on rewriting their tumultuous history.

Indiana's Scorched Earth Journey

This victory is more than just a feather in the cap for the Hoosiers; it's the culmination of an unimaginable transformation. From a program marked by adversity, with 715 losses historically—the second most in FBS history—Indiana now proudly joins an elite list of teams that can claim a 16-0 record.

Despite entering the contest as underdogs, Indiana's resolve, led by Heisman Trophy-winning quarterback Fernando Mendoza, was palpable. Mendoza engineered a crucial fourth-down touchdown run late in the game, showcasing not only skill but a relentless drive to win. His determination mirrored that of his team—a collective heart willing to turn every setback into motivation.

A Meeting of Titans

Taking the field, the Hoosiers faced a Miami team boasting 45 four-to-five-star recruits compared to Indiana's eight. Despite this imbalance, the game showcased the power of teamwork and strategy over pure talent.

Defensive Dominance

Defensively, Indiana proved its mettle, executing plays with precision and blocking crucial Miami attempts, including a rare fourth-quarter interception by Jamari Sharpe. Such moments were essential in stifling any late-game momentum the Hurricanes tried to build. The pivotal block in the second half brought the crowd to its feet, and the energy shifted dramatically in favor of the Hoosiers.

A Historic Offensive Showcase

Despite its earlier struggles, Indiana's offense, known for outscoring opponents by an impressive margin, never wavered when it counted the most. In fact, they have shown remarkable ability to score in the second quarter, putting up 198 points this season—an unmatched feat in the FBS. As the game unfolded, Miami managed to close the gap to just three points, but indecisiveness and penalties plagued the Hurricanes, highlighting the difficulties faced by teams under pressure.

The Heart of the Hoosiers

This win isn't just a statistical anomaly—it's a testament to what can happen when a team commits to belief and hard work. Coach Cignetti has led this program from 27-2 in two seasons, reversing a previous era marked by disappointment into one filled with hope and possibility.
